#b140e1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b140e1 is composed of 69.4% red, 25.1%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.3% cyan, 71.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 282.1 degrees, a saturation of 72.9% and a lightness of 56.7%. #b140e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ff80ff with #6300c3.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#b140e1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09020c is the darkest color, while #fdf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b140e1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928d95 is the less saturated color, while #bb27fb is the most saturated one.
